Masters of the Universe film debuts in Brazil with new Skeletor villain

The live‑action adaptation of the classic He‑Man franchise, Masters of the Universe, opened in Brazilian cinemas on 5 June 2026. Directed by Travis Knight, the movie follows Prince Adam (Nicholas Galitzine) on his journey to Eternia, where he confronts the formidable Skeletor, portrayed by Jared Leto. The cast also includes Camila Mendes as Teela, Idris Elba as Duncan, and features a supporting ensemble that blends nostalgic references with modern updates.

Critics highlighted the film’s visual scale, elaborate set pieces, and a soundtrack that amplifies the action. The production incorporates numerous Easter eggs and three post‑credit scenes that tease future storylines, including the introduction of She‑Ra and a hint that Skeletor may return. Overall, the release aims to satisfy longtime fans while attracting a new generation of viewers.
